Venue Review of Christmas at Kensington Palace

Set in tranquil gardens in the heart of west London, Kensington Palace first became a royal residence for William and Mary in 1689. The Royal couple commissioned Sir Christopher Wren to create a palace retreat away from Whitehall &, despite its central location, the venue still feels cut off from the bustle of its surroundings today. Also the birthplace & childhood home of Queen Victoria, the palace has hosted the courts of countless kings & queens over the centuries & has an unmistakably regal feel which suits only the grandest events. A Christmas party can begin with pre-dinner drinks in the Queen’s Gallery, with its rich 17th-century interiors, before dinner in the beautiful Orangery.
